Are we getting a Castlevania spinoff on Netflix?

Short answer is maybe. We’re possibly getting a Castlevania spinoff. In an April article from Deadline, which reported the news of Castlevania ending with season 4, it said, “I hear Netflix is eyeing a new series set in the same Castlevania universe with an entirely new cast of characters.” Producer Kevin Kolde told Monsters & Critics that Netflix is “definitely looking at continuing the Castlevania universe”.

One of the main differences, however, would be the creative team for the hypothetical yet highly likely spinoff series. Castlevania’s creator & head writer Warren Ellis was revealed to be a garbage human being when more than 60 women & nonbinary individuals came forward to accuse him of sexual misconduct on the website So Many Of Us

Whether Castlevania was ending naturally before the news broke is irrelevant. It’s ended now. This means that any series coming after it will probably not have the cloud of Ellis’s scandal around it since a new team will be brought on. Deadline wrote, “I hear he also has not been part of the conversations about a potential new show, which likely won’t include him as a creative auspice.”
